WebIt is a common neurological condition in dogs, with no predisposition to sex or breed. Disorientation, head tilt, and loss of balance are all common to an upset in the vestibular system. This system is responsible for maintaining and stabilizing the position of the head (which thereby gives the body stability), and the eyes during head movements. Sudden Joint or Muscle Pain. If your dog screams when touched it might have a sudden muscle spasm or cramp, and the shock of the sensation can make your dog scream for help. Just like when a person yells out when they get a leg or stomach cramp, your dog has a similar reaction to that kind of pain. impurity\u0027s rh

WebDuring the Seizure. Once the actual seizure begins your Chihuahua may twitch and jerk about or her limbs might stiffen and appear to be paralyzed. She won't be able to stand and may begin kicking her legs in a swimming action. Your little Chi will probably drool and may develop a little foam around her mouth.
